The first way to start your oral care regime is to simply pay a visit to your dentist for a check-up of your teeth and gums and mouth. This should be ideally done every six months in order to treat and prevent any oral health issues that may arise. Brushing your teeth regularly is a not only good dental hygiene but also healthy practice. Most people undermine the value of a balanced diet and maintaining good oral hygiene. A Healthy diet is vital for maintaining and building on and strengthening your general and oral health. Avoiding junk food and snacks with high sugar content and starches could help maintain healthy teeth, especially if you are an adult as they are one of the main causes of oral health problems. Carefully monitoring and controlling the amount of snacks you eat through the day will also help in maintaining a healthy diet and staying generally healthy. Gum disease is also a sign of bad oral health and could lead to bad breath as well as several more serious medical conditions.
So keep a look out for any sign of gum disease, if you notice slight bleeding of the gums, bad breath and sores, you should consult your dentist at the earliest possible time in order to get treatment and prevent the condition getting any worse. Smoking and chewing tobacco are also dangerous detrimental to your oral health. Tobacco can lead to oral cancer and a variety of other cancers such as gum and lung which can result in death.
